Designed by Jean Prouve' in 1930, the reclining chairs made of steel and canvas are a remarkable piece of French design. Initially created as a gift for the wedding of Prouvé's sister, only eight of these chairs were ever produced. In 1982, Tecta collaborated with Prouvé to revive the design for a limited edition run. The elegant chair comprises of two steel tubes connected by a welded steel part and features red canvas upholstery with a seat cushion and two back bars. This folding chair is a rare and coveted piece of furniture design.
